How Slot Games Improve Gameplay Readability

Gameplay readability in slot games refers to how easily players can understand the game’s 99ok mechanics, symbols, and potential outcomes. Clear readability ensures that players can focus on enjoyment rather than confusion.

Clear Symbol Design

Designers use distinct, recognizable symbols with contrasting colors and shapes. This helps players quickly identify winning combinations and special features without strain.

Intuitive Paytables

Well-organized paytables provide all necessary information about payouts, bonuses, and special symbols. Players can easily reference them, which enhances decision-making during gameplay.

Legible Fonts and UI Elements

Text clarity is crucial for readability. Slot games use legible fonts, proper sizing, and clear placement for information such as credits, bets, and win amounts.

Visual Hierarchy

Games highlight important elements, like active paylines or bonus triggers, using visual cues. This prioritization guides players’ attention to what matters most in real time.

Animation and Feedback

Dynamic animations, such as highlighting winning symbols or showing cascading reels, make outcomes immediately understandable. Immediate visual feedback reinforces gameplay comprehension.

Cross-Platform Consistency

Ensuring that readability is maintained across devices—from desktops to mobile phones—prevents confusion and keeps the gaming experience smooth and accessible.
